[7/9] / [2/3]
This is division of fractions.
Remember the rule for division of fractions.
CHANGE THE SIGN THE MULTIPLY (X) AND INVER(TURN OVER) THE DENOMINATING FRACTION. Then proceed as multiplying fractions.
Hence
7/9 X 3/2
Cancel down by '3'
Hence
7/3 X 1/2 = 7/6
Convert to mixed fraction.
1 1/6 The answer!!!!!

To determine how many sixths are in two thirds, you need to convert both fractions to have a common denominator. In this case, the common denominator is 6. Two thirds is equivalent to four sixths, so there are four sixths in two thirds. This can be calculated by multiplying the numerator and denominator of two thirds by 2 to get 4/6.

Two-thirds is equal to six-ninths. This is because when you convert two-thirds to ninths, you multiply the numerator and denominator of two-thirds (2/3) by 3, resulting in 6/9. Therefore, there are six ninths in two-thirds.
